What happens when the credit card is frozen?
As we all know, it is a long-term solution to use credit cards according to regulations, but there are still many people who use their cards at will with luck, either owing money or illegally cashing out, and regret it only after the credit card application platform freezes the cards. However, how to judge whether the credit card is frozen?

1, the use of credit cards is restricted:

If the cardholder finds that the credit card cannot be used normally, it means that the card has been frozen. In this case, the cardholder can contact the bank customer service to inquire about the specific situation. If it is because the bank is suspected of cashing out, and the cardholder himself has no such behavior, he can submit a consumption voucher and ask the bank to cancel this risk control.

2. Warning message or phone call from the bank:

If the cardholder receives a warning message or phone call from the bank in the process of using the credit card, reminding everyone to use the card properly, which means that the credit card will be frozen. At this time, everyone should pay attention to the use of credit cards, and never violate the rules again, otherwise the credit cards will be frozen and cannot be thawed in a short time.
